The Battle of Gagron was fought in 1519 between Sultan Mahmud Khalji II of Malwa and Rana Sanga of Mewar. The conflict took place in Gagron and resulted in Sanga's victory, with him taking Mahmud captive and annexing significant territory. Wikipedia

Date: 1519

Result: Mewari victory, Sultan Mahmud Khalji II taken prisoner

Location: Gagron Fort, Gagron

Territorial changes: Eastern Malwa and the forts of Ranthambore and Chanderi ceded to Rana Sanga
